Portable vacuum sealing machine
By adopting an upper and lower opposing arched frame structure and a central protruding rib design in the vacuum sealing machine, the problem of poor sealing caused by deformation under wet sealing conditions has been solved, achieving higher quality sealing effect and extending equipment life.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to a sealing machine technical field, specifically to a portable vacuum sealing machine. BACKGROUND
[0002] The vacuum sealing machine is a kind of equipment that can effectively isolate air and contact with goods. It is mainly composed of vacuum pump, vacuum chamber, heating sealing device and other parts. When working, first, the goods to be packaged are placed in the special packaging bag and placed in the vacuum chamber, the equipment starts the vacuum pump, and the air in the bag is extracted to form a vacuum environment, so as to inhibit the growth and reproduction of microorganisms and prolong the shelf life of goods.
[0003] At present, most of the vacuum type heat sealing bag machines on the market have poor wet extraction sealing bag effect under the working condition of wet extraction function, and even cannot realize the function. The reason is that the structure of all current vacuum heat sealing bag machines basically adopts an upper cover pre-deformation structure, as shown in Figure 1 , 01 is the lower shell and heating wire, and 02 is the upper shell and silica gel pressing strip.
[0004] After using the structure for a period of time, the upper shell and silica gel pressing strip will be flat, and when the product works together, a bulge gap will be formed between the upper shell and silica gel pressing strip and the lower shell and heating wire, as shown in Figure 2 , which causes the bag to be pressed, resulting in poor bag sealing. INVENTION CONTENTS
[0005] The utility model aims at providing a portable vacuum sealing machine with long service life to solve the problems raised in the above background technology.
[0006] To achieve the above purpose, the technical scheme of the utility model is as follows.
[0007] A portable vacuum sealing machine, comprising a base and a cover body hingedly installed on the base, the inside of the base is provided with a lower shell, the lower shell is provided with a heating unit, and the heating unit is an arc-shaped structure with the middle part protruding upward. The inside of the cover body is provided with an upper shell, and the upper shell is provided with a flexible pressing strip corresponding to the heating unit, and the flexible pressing strip is an arc-shaped structure with the middle part protruding downward.
[0008] Therefore, by adopting the overall upper and lower arch frame structure, no matter how the upper shell deforms in the later use process, the deformed upper shell and flexible pressing strip can be tightly attached to the heating unit through the frame arch structure of the lower shell, and the phenomenon of poor bag sealing under the wet extraction mode is solved.
[0009] Further, the lower rib with the middle part protruding upward is formed on the base. The upper rib with the middle part protruding downward is formed on the cover body. The overall structural strength of the base and the cover body is strengthened, and the possibility of deformation is reduced.
[0010] Further, the lower rib is formed on the lower shell of the base, and the heating unit is arranged on the lower rib. The upper rib is formed on the upper shell of the cover, and the flexible pressing strip is arranged on the upper rib. The frame arch structure can tightly fit the deformed upper shell and the flexible pressing strip to the heating unit.
[0011] Further, the heat insulation piece is arranged between the heating unit and the lower shell, the middle part of the heat insulation piece is upwardly protruded and tightly fitted to the lower side of the heating unit. The influence of heat on other components is reduced, and the loss of heat is reduced.
[0012] Further, the elastic piece is arranged between the heat insulation piece and the lower shell. The elastic piece can play a buffering role in the pressing process.
[0013] Further, the lower surface of the lower shell is fixed with the metal fixing seat with the metal spring on both sides. The two ends of the heating unit are buckled on the metal spring through the metal ring on the electrode. The electrode on the heating unit is convenient to assemble and disassemble.
[0014] Further, the surface of the upper shell is provided with the mounting groove, the upper side of the flexible pressing strip is provided with the lug, and the lug is embedded in the mounting groove. The lug is convenient to assemble, disassemble and replace.
[0015]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of the present application are as follows.
[0016] The present application adopts the overall upper and lower opposite arch frame structure, and no matter how the upper shell is deformed in the later use process, the deformed upper shell and the flexible pressing strip can be tightly fitted to the heating unit through the frame arch structure of the lower shell, so that the phenomenon of poor bag sealing in the wet extraction mode is solved.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0027] As shown in Figures 1-8 A portable vacuum sealing machine, comprising a base 1 and a cover 2 hingedly installed on the base 1, the inside of the base 1 is provided with a lower shell 106, the lower shell 106 is provided with a heating unit 101, and the heating unit 101 is an arc-shaped structure with a middle part protruding upward. The inside of the cover 2 is provided with an upper shell 205, and the upper shell 205 is provided with a flexible pressure strip 201 at a position corresponding to the heating unit 101, and the flexible pressure strip 201 is an arc-shaped structure with a middle part protruding downward.
[0028] In addition, an execution unit (not shown) is arranged on the base 1. The heating unit 101 is a heating wire, and the flexible pressure strip 201 is preferably a silica gel pressure strip. A vacuum extraction unit (not shown) is arranged on the base 1. The lower concave cavity 103 is arranged on the base 1 and faces one side of the cover 2, and when the cover 2 is buckled with the base 1, the lower concave cavity 103 and the cover 2 jointly form a negative pressure cavity. The lower concave cavity 103 is provided with an air extraction hole 105, and the vacuum extraction unit is connected with the lower concave cavity 103 through a pipeline (not shown) and the air extraction hole 105. The main parts of the portable sealing machine 100 are arranged on the base 1, and the cover 2 is provided with a vacuum button 207, a sealing button 208, a dry-wet mode switching button 209 and an automatic sealing button 210 for inputting instructions.
[0029] In addition, the cover 2 is also provided with an upper concave cavity 203 to increase the volume of the negative pressure cavity. The base 1 and the cover 2 are respectively provided with a lower sealing ring 104 and an upper sealing ring 204. The lower sealing ring 104 and the upper sealing ring 204 are made of elastic material to increase the sealing performance.
[0030] Preferably, the base 1 is formed with a lower rib 102 which is upwardly convex in the middle. The cover 2 is formed with an upper rib 202 which is downwardly convex in the middle.
[0031] The lower rib 102 and the upper rib 202 are used to strengthen the overall structural strength of the base 1 and the cover 2 and reduce the possibility of deformation.
[0032] Preferably, the lower rib 102 is formed on the lower shell 106 of the base 1, and the heating unit 101 is arranged on the lower rib 102. The upper rib 202 is formed on the upper shell 205 of the cover 2, and the flexible pressing strip 201 is arranged on the upper rib 202.
[0033] No matter how the upper shell 205 is deformed during the later use, the deformed upper shell 205 can be tightly attached to the flexible pressing strip 201 and the heating unit 101 through the frame arch structure of the lower shell 106, so that the phenomenon of poor bag sealing in the wet extraction mode is solved.
[0034] Preferably, a heat insulation piece 3 is arranged between the heating unit 101 and the lower shell 106. The heat insulation piece 3 is upwardly convex in the middle and is attached to the lower side of the heating unit 101.
[0035] Through the arrangement of the heat insulation piece 3, the influence of heat on other components can be reduced.
[0036] In addition, the heat insulation piece 3 is preferably a mica sheet. The side of the heating unit 101 facing the cover 2 is provided with a heat-resistant layer (not shown). (This component is used to avoid exposure of the heating wire and is not necessary.)
[0037] Preferably, an elastic piece 301 is arranged between the heat insulation piece 3 and the lower shell 106.
[0038] Through the arrangement of the elastic piece 301, a buffering effect can be achieved during the pressing process. The elastic piece 301 is preferably a silica gel pad.
[0039] Preferably, the lower surface of the lower shell 106 is fixed with a metal fixing seat 4 having a metal spring 401 on both sides. The two ends of the heating unit 101 are buckled on the metal spring 401 through the metal ring 4021 on the electrode 402.
[0040] Through the connection structure, the electrode 402 on the heating unit 101 is convenient to assemble and disassemble.
[0041] Preferably, the surface of the upper shell 205 is provided with a mounting groove 206, and the upper side of the flexible pressing strip 201 is provided with a lug 5 which is embedded in the mounting groove 206.
[0042] Through the mounting structure, the lug 5 is convenient to mount, dismount and replace.
[0043] As shown in Figure 8 the portable sealing machine 100 comprises a storage unit, an instruction input unit, a control unit, an execution unit and a heating unit 101. The control unit is electrically connected with the storage unit, the instruction input unit and the execution unit respectively, and the execution unit is electrically connected with the heating unit 101. The storage unit stores a heating control curve corresponding to the cumulative number of heating, the instruction input unit is used for receiving a heating instruction and sending the heating instruction to the control unit, and the control unit receives the heating instruction and sends a target heating time as a heating instruction to the execution unit. After starting, if the heating instruction is received for the first time, the control unit takes the predetermined heating time as the target heating time; after starting, if the heating instruction is received for the second time, the control unit obtains the heating control curve corresponding to the cumulative number of heating from the storage unit, and obtains the target heating time according to the time difference between the adjacent two heating and the selected heating control curve. The execution unit receives the heating instruction and outputs the current to the heating unit 101 according to the heating instruction.
[0044] The vacuum button 207 is used for inputting a vacuum drawing instruction and a vacuum canceling instruction. When the portable sealing machine 100 is in an idle state, pressing the vacuum button 207 can input the vacuum drawing instruction; when the portable sealing machine 100 is in a vacuum state, pressing the vacuum button 207 can input the vacuum canceling instruction.
[0045] The sealing button 208 is used for inputting a heating instruction and a heating canceling instruction. When the portable sealing machine 100 is in an idle state, pressing the sealing button 208 can input the heating instruction; when the portable sealing machine 100 is in a heating state, pressing the sealing button 208 can input the heating canceling instruction.
[0046] The dry-wet mode switching button 209 is used for inputting a dry-wet mode switching instruction. When the object to be sealed is a dry object, the dry mode is used, and when the object to be sealed is a wet object, the wet mode is used. The difference between the two modes is that the vacuum drawing time in the wet mode is longer than that in the dry mode.
[0047] The automatic sealing button 210 is used for inputting a vacuum drawing heating instruction and a termination instruction. When the portable sealing machine 100 is in an idle state, pressing the automatic sealing button 210 can input the vacuum drawing instruction and the heating instruction; when the portable sealing machine 100 is in any working state, pressing the automatic sealing button 210 can input the termination instruction, so that the portable sealing machine 100 returns to the idle state. Here, any working state includes a single vacuum drawing working state, a single heating working state, and a vacuum drawing and simultaneous heating working state.
